Sinai Health (SH) is committed to providing a safe environment for all students. Under the Occupational Health
and Safety Act (OHSA) employers must provide instruction, information, policies and procedures to safely
conduct work. Employers must take every reasonable precaution to protect the health and safety of students.

Review the process for responding if a student is involved in a workplace incident:
o If first aid treatment is required, report to the OHS Clinic at MSH (60 Murray
Workplace Street, 1st floor) or BAH (G.057). Hours of operation: M-F, 7:30am-3:30pm
Incidents and o If OHS is closed or major medical attention is required, visit the Mount Sinai
Illnesses Emergency Department
o Students and their preceptors must complete an incident report (SAFER) for all
work-related incidents/illnesses/hazards
